Address 0 PPC

PSJ85qYWW7R3zJXrRgcXVS6hjQe7vQxpLg

Confirmed

Total Received19.91222 PPC
Total Sent19.91222 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PQ9BK7xeZJFRTozq8PUkhtzX2GGn8qDgWB80.98 PPC
PSJ85qYWW7R3zJXrRgcXVS6hjQe7vQxpLg19.91222 PPC
Fee: 0.01 PPC
566418 Confirmations100.88222 PPC
PSJ85qYWW7R3zJXrRgcXVS6hjQe7vQxpLg19.91222 PPC
PD8Aejmng2sTV6jdqiyb5VJNtB4FQrpGoS26.022452 PPC
Fee: 0.01 PPC
566459 Confirmations45.934672 PPC